I want to instill a love of reading and all things literacy in my Kindergartners and keep them engaged in their learning. This will be my fourth year teaching Kindergarten. Over the past three years, I have noticed that more and more of my students are coming in with a lack of exposure to books.
This fall I will have a class of at least 25 kindergarten students who are eager to learn and explore through reading. The school that I work at is a Title 1 school with 100% of the population receiving free breakfast and lunch each day. They will enter Kindergarten in September with many different interests, backgrounds, cultures, and reading levels. Students love reading and making new discoveries that they can share with their peers.
I would like to provide my students unique opportunities to experience books at many different levels and interests they may have. My students need six individual CD players, 6 headphones for our listening center, and books with CDs.
